If you stop in Calgary, there are decent bike lanes and transit near the centre is okish. The transit from the airport is slow af unfortunately. There are some nice places to walk near the river! If you’re hiking in the mountains then yes you need a car but if you want to see cute mountain towns then I think there’s flixbus that goes to either Canmore or Banff from Calgary, and the roam public transit buses once you’re there are good! There’s also a paved bike track between Banff & Canmore

I also didn’t think I would mind the commute but it is brutal, especially in the winter. Getting to the mountains takes so much longer than further north in the city (unless you’re going to Bragg or south kananaskis). Lived here almost a year and still haven’t used the lake facilities bc once we’re home from work we’re just tired tbh If you do move, just make sure you’re in walking distance to a shop. We are not and having to drive even just to get a loaf of bread or milk is annoying! And the parking lot at the shops in mahogany is a nightmare. We moved from Marda loop because of the construction and I hate to say it but I think i still prefer Marda, despite its construction chaos

Lake o hara booking day is mid-Jan (check online for this year!) and usually opens at 8am Pacific time. Have multiple browsers open and in the queue before then to try and get a spot on the website, and then good luck navigating the website, and keep your fingers crossed you get something 🫡
